PURPOSE:To reduce the self discharge which occurs in a short leaving time after charging by using thick electrode plates and allocating and installing anode at both sides of cathode, so that the reduction reaction of oxygen gas proceeds fast and efficiently. CONSTITUTION:An anode active substance and a cathode active substance are coated on each grid plate which is divided by insulator 5 of collector 4 so that an anode plate 2 and a cathode plate are formed 1, and an electrolyte solution carrier 3 is installed in the thickness direction. Thick electrode plates are permissible, so that they are prevented from torsion and twist and durable against physical changes of the active substances in their use, and no space is formed between the electrode plate and the separator member. By the arrangement, capture and reduction recovery of oxygen gas generated at the cathode plate during charging are easily and fast carried out, and almost all of oxygen gas are captured and reduced at the anode when charging is completed resulting in a remarkable reduction of residual oxygen gas. |
